A way to uninstall Grammarly for Windows from your system

This info is about Grammarly for Windows for Windows. Below you can find details on how to uninstall it from your PC. The Windows version was developed by Grammarly. Additional info about Grammarly can be seen here. Usually the Grammarly for Windows application is found in the C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\Grammarly\DesktopIntegrations directory, depending on the user's option during install. The entire uninstall command line for Grammarly for Windows is C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\Grammarly\DesktopIntegrations\Uninstall.exe. Grammarly.Desktop.exe is the programs's main file and it takes close to 252.09 KB (258136 bytes) on disk.

Grammarly for Windows installs the following the executables on your PC, occupying about 10.08 MB (10571264 bytes) on disk.

  • Grammarly.Desktop.exe (252.09 KB)
  • Grammarly.WebUI.exe (7.50 MB)
  • Uninstall.exe (2.34 MB)
